A workflow model based on fuzzy-timing Petri nets

Time information management in workflow has been recognized as one of the most significant tasks in workflow management. The uncertainties in time and time-related constraints in workflow models should be taken into consideration. Based on introducing time constraints on elements in fuzzy-timing Petri nets, this paper propose a new workflow model named fuzzy temporal workflow nets (FTWF-nets). The calculation of temporal elements in FTWF-nets is given. Then time modeling and time possibility analysis of temporal phenomena in FTWF-nets are investigated. Finally an example is given to illustrate how to use these methods. Research results show that FTWF-nets can be used to model time information in those workflows, which have time uncertainty and have time constraints on resources and activities, and analyze the time possibility on some constraints.
